JACKSONVILLE, Fla. — Family and friends are grieving after a father of four was shot and killed in Mandarin Monday evening. According to the Jacksonville Sheriff's Office, 43-year-old Stephen Shahly was discovered dead inside a garage on Rustic Green Court. Officers had been called to the area due to reports of gunfire around 5:30 p.m. Monday.
JSO announced Tuesday evening that it arrested 44-year-old Donald Rentfrow Jr. for the shooting. He was taken into custody Tuesday morning as investigators and SWAT conducted a search warrant at his home, JSO said, and quickly booked into the Duval County jail.
Shahly's soon-to-be brother-in-law rushed to the scene as soon as he heard about the shooting.
